Understanding ADHD
ADHD is identified by symptoms such as neg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siveness. These symptoms can significantly impact a person's scholastic, occupational, and social life. Identifying ADHD typically involves an extensive assessment conducted by a health care professional.

The pathway to obtaining a Private Adhd Assessment Aberdeen ADHD assessment generally involves several actions:
1. Preliminary Consultation
The first action generally starts with an initial assessment where people discuss their symptoms and interest in a certified specialist. This could be a psychiatrist, psychologist, or professional nurse.
What to Expect:
A summary of signsDiscussion of household history and co-existing conditionsA mental health check-up2. Diagnostic Evaluation
As soon as the initial consultation is done, the next stage is the diagnostic examination. This consists of:
Clinical Interview: An extensive discussion to assess ADHD signs.Standardized Rating Scales: These questionnaires assist assess severity and frequency of symptoms.Security Information: Input from member of the family or instructors to comprehend how the individual acts in different environments.3. Feedback Session
After the assessments are completed, a feedback session is usually scheduled to talk about the findings. During this session, individuals will receive:
Explanation of resultsDiagnosis (if appropriate)Recommendations for treatment or management4. Treatment Plan
If a diagnosis of ADHD is validated, the clinician will go over a tailored treatment plan, which may include:

The procedure can differ, however it typically includes a preliminary consultation and the diagnostic evaluation, which can take a few hours. The entire procedure, including feedback and treatment strategy solution, may extend to a few weeks.
2. Will my insurance cover the assessment?
Lots of private clinics accept medical insurance, however protection depends upon the specifics of your policy. It is advisable to check with your insurance coverage provider in advance.
3. What happens if I get a diagnosis?
If identified with ADHD, the clinician will provide a treatment strategy customized for you. This might consist of treatment, medication, or even more assessments.
4. Are assessments available for kids as well?
Yes, lots of centers provide assessments specifically developed for children, with factors to consider for their special developmental stages.
